Advantages and disadvantages of Asphalt Shingles



Asphalt shingles are one of one of the most prominent roof materials for homeowners due to their cost and simplicity of setup. They can be found in a range of shades and styles, permitting you to match your home's aesthetic.

Among the most significant benefits is the price; asphalt tiles are normally less costly than other roof products. Their setup is straightforward, making it quick and convenient for contractors to place them on your roofing.


Nevertheless, there are some disadvantages to think about. Asphalt tiles normally have a shorter life-span, balancing around 15 to 30 years, depending on the top quality.

They're additionally susceptible to damage from high winds and hail, which can cause expensive repair work. In addition, asphalt tiles aren't the most green option, as they're petroleum-based and can add to land fill waste at the end of their life.
